If not, see . */ #include #include /* Internal state used by the functions mbsrtowcs() and mbsnrtowcs(). */ mbstate_t _gl_mbsrtowcs_state /* The state must initially be in the "initial state"; so, zero-initialize it. On most systems, putting it into BSS is sufficient. Not so on Mac OS X 10.3, see . When it needs an initializer, use 0 or {0} as initializer? 0 only works when mbstate_t is a scalar type (such as when gnulib defines it, or on AIX, IRIX, mingw). {0} works as an initializer in all cases: for a struct or union type, but also for a scalar type (ISO C 99, 6.7.8.(11)). */ #if defined __ELF__ /* On ELF systems, variables in BSS behave well. */ #else /* Use braces, to be on the safe side. */ = { 0 } #endif ;
